Experience
As a developmental editor, I work with thought leaders in the fields of leadership, management, diversity, inclusion, and equity, creativity, entrepreneurship, social justice and social responsibility, sustainability, personal development, expanding consciousness, and health and wellness.
Born and raised in Trinidad, I lived in Miami and LA before moving to San Francisco in 2012. My background makes me particularly interested in books that center the experiences of immigrants, people of color, and women, and that help individuals to create the space for all their identities to thrive. My authors have been published by Berrett-Koehler Publishers, St. Martin's Press, Jossey-Bass (Wiley), Sounds True, Dutton (Penguin Random House), Hatherleigh Press, W. Brand Publishing, and Pepperdine University. As a managing editor, I've designed editorial processes and set up publishing schedules. I have recruited, trained and managed teams of editors, writers, and production designers. I've worked on site and off, collaborating across business functions and time zones to develop and market new editorial products, implement changes to content and style guidelines, and measure the success of past endeavors. Previously, I was the Managing Editor of Pepperdine Business School's applied business research journal and of the US and China industry research departments of IBISWorld, a market research firm. |
